Toyota Tundra Service Manual: Disassembly

DISASSEMBLY

PROCEDURE

1. REMOVE HOOD BULGE ASSEMBLY

(a) Put protective tape around the hood bulge assembly.

Text in Illustration

*1

Protective Tape

(b) Remove the 3 bolts.

(c) Detach the 8 clips and remove the hood bulge assembly.

2. REMOVE HOOD TO RADIATOR SUPPORT SEAL

(a) Using a clip remover, remove the 10 clips and hood to radiator support seal.

3. REMOVE HOOD INSULATOR (w/ Hood Insulator)

(a) Using a clip remover, remove the 10 clips.

(b) Detach the 2 guides and remove the hood insulator.

4. REMOVE FRONT WASHER NOZZLE AND HOSE ASSEMBLY

5. REMOVE WASHER HOSE ASSEMBLY

(a) Disconnect the washer hose assembly.

(b) Detach the 3 clamps and remove the washer hose assembly.
